Latest Patents

Yoshihiro Seimiya holds a patent for a method of manufacturing a massive mixture of aluminum nitride and aluminum. This method involves a first heat treatment process where aluminum powder and aluminum pieces are heated in a vessel at a temperature equal to or greater than the melting point of aluminum under a nitrogen atmosphere. During this process, an oxide film forms over the surface of the aluminum powder, which can be a natural oxide film. The weight ratio of the aluminum powder to the aluminum pieces is typically 0.1 or less, showcasing a precise control over the material composition.
